Pouring tips: All ribbon tail molds like to be shot warm the first time. Once they are warm they shoot easily. Here are a couple tips to ensure a complete tail:
1) Before shooting the first time rub a drop of worm oil in the tail
2) Shoot it a little warmer than normal the first time
3) Clamp it really well in the front and back (always use 2 or more bar clamps) and inject with slightly more pressure the first time
